Output 73830d331a3ef7f7a6ea1fd9d02324fa2e1a1424ff6579b5244ff53d84d1e3ad:61

value
3041076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08290d4abf91e5825e4ad62ac96484803cd66b06 OP_EQUAL
address
32SAWR5Sb17atdCM2K97JXapCFWVBqs2uw
transaction
73830d331a3ef7f7a6ea1fd9d02324fa2e1a1424ff6579b5244ff53d84d1e3ad
spent
false